Framed Partitions
Most framed Glass Partition systems are built to hold panes of glass that are bonded to the frame with a special silicone sealing. This makes the transition from glass to metal nearly invisible, while also providing an extra level of strength for the panels.
These framed systems can be made from a wide range of building materials, including aluminum or stainless steel. These materials are usually affordable and provide a strong base for the glass panels, while offering some resistance to corrosion.
The most common option for a framed glass partition is an aluminum-framed system, which is very popular in offices because of its light weight and durability. Other options include wood and a frameless, slimmer profile system.
